Eight Killed In Minibus Taxi And Truck Collision Along N4, Near Waterval Onder

Mbombela (Nelspruit) – Eight people were killed on Tuesday morning, 16 June 2026, when a minibus taxi and a truck collided on the N4 Toll Road between Ngodwana and Waterval Onder, towards Waterval Boven.

One person sustained critical injuries.

The Mpumalanga Department of Community Safety, Security, and Liaison said the cause of the crash was unclear

“An investigation is currently underway at the scene. More details will be communicated in due course,” the department said in a terse statement.

Speaking to Newzroom Afrika TV (channel 405) at the scene, Mpumalanga Spokesperson for Community Safety, Security and Liaison, Moeti Mmusi, said the bodies were taken to a state morgue in Belfast.

Their next of kin would be notified to identify the deceased.

Mmusi said their preliminary investigation revealed that the minibus taxi was travelling from Mozambique to Johannesburg.

“The minibus taxi has a Mozambique-registered number plate,” the spokesperson said.

The truck was transporting goods to a retailer in Malelane, near Mbombela.
